Project Overview
Federal Synergies successfully completed a comprehensive drone-based survey of CESC Ltd's LT (Low Tension) network, covering 100 distribution transformers and their associated infrastructure. This innovative approach combined aerial surveying with thermal imaging to revolutionize network maintenance practices, resulting in significant cost savings and improved reliability.
Project Scope & Achievements
Key Metrics
Survey coverage: 100 distribution transformers
Cost reduction: 40% decrease in O&M expenses
Outcome: Significant reduction in potential downtime
Deliverables: Detailed asset maps and thermal analysis reports
Technical Implementation
Survey Methodology
Our team deployed advanced drones equipped with:
High-resolution RGB cameras
Thermal imaging sensors
GPS mapping technology
Asset tracking capabilities
Data Collection Process
For each transformer location, we conducted:
Aerial mapping of overhead network infrastructure
Thermal imaging of all connection points
Detailed RGB photography of network components
GPS tracking of asset locations
Comprehensive condition assessment
